MUMBAI-Filmmaker Indrajit Lankesh has revisited one of the most memorable moments of his career, recalling how he launched Deepika Padukone in her acting debut with the Kannada film ‘Aishwarya’.

Speaking to IANS, Lankesh said he was looking for a new heroine when someone recommended Deepika. He revealed that their first meeting was arranged by Pooja Dadlani, who managed Deepika Padukone at the time and is now Shah Rukh Khan’s manager.

“I was looking for a new heroine, and someone recommended Deepika,” Lankesh said.

“We met in a lift, and I started narrating the story. I had barely spoken two lines when she was convinced. That’s how Deepika was cast in ‘Aishwarya’. She already had the confidence. I just created an atmosphere where she could perform fearlessly.”

Lankesh said he immediately recognized Deepika’s potential.

“She had the height, the look, the screen presence, and, most importantly, the hunger to prove herself. I told her one day she’d become a Hollywood star. Years later, when she worked with Vin Diesel, I remembered that conversation.”

The filmmaker also clarified that Deepika was not working on ‘Om Shanti Om’ while filming ‘Aishwarya’. According to Lankesh, Shah Rukh Khan cast her in the Hindi film only after ‘Aishwarya’ completed a successful 100-day theatrical run.

‘Aishwarya’, directed by Lankesh, marked Deepika Padukone’s acting debut opposite Upendra in 2006. (IANS)
